Iceland is about 38 times bigger than Rhode Island.
Rhode Island is approximately 2,706 sq km, while Iceland is approximately 103,000 sq km, making Iceland 3,706% larger than Rhode Island. Meanwhile, the population of Rhode Island is ~1.1 million people (694,964 fewer people live in Iceland).
